Original Description
Theodore Rousseau's The Vallee de la Bievre near Paris (1829–1831) captures the serene beauty of the French countryside with remarkable atmospheric depth. Painted during Rousseau's early career, this work exemplifies his foundational role in the Barbizon School—a movement that pioneered plein air painting and laid the groundwork for Impressionism. The composition draws viewers into a tranquil valley, where delicate light filters through lush foliage and reflects off the gently winding Bievre River. Rousseau’s meticulous brushwork renders textures—soft grasses, rugged tree bark, and shifting skies—with almost tactile realism, while his subdued yet harmonious palette evokes tranquility. Though less dramatic than his later, more celebrated works, this piece is historically significant as an early indicator of Rousseau’s lifelong dedication to nature’s quiet poetry, diverging from idealized Romantic landscapes prevalent at the time.
